February Weather in West Bend,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In February, the average temperature in West Bend, United States hovers around -7°C (19°F). This chilly month can see temperatures plummet to a frigid -31°C (-24°F), while occasionally reaching a balmy 20°C (68°F). With precipitation measured at 45 mm (1.8 in) over approximately 8 days, and an average humidity level of 84%, be prepared for a damp and cold experience!

How February Weather in West Bend Compares to Other Months

Weather in West Bend var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ares February’s weather to other months in West Bend,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in West Bend, showing how February’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-7°C (20°F)30 mm (1.2 inches)82%moderate
February Weather-7°C (19°F)45 mm (1.8 inches)84%moderate
March Weather2°C (36°F)74 mm (2.9 inches)80%moderate
April Weather8°C (46°F)91 mm (3.6 inches)81%very high
May Weather16°C (61°F)156 mm (6.1 inches)74%very high
June Weather23°C (73°F)125 mm (4.9 inches)80%extreme
July Weather24°C (75°F)88 mm (3.5 inches)80%very high
August Weather22°C (72°F)121 mm (4.8 inches)77%very high
September Weather19°C (66°F)113 mm (4.4 inches)75%very high
October Weather10°C (50°F)105 mm (4.1 inches)80%moderate
November Weather2°C (36°F)39 mm (1.5 inches)87%moderate
December Weather-3°C (28°F)42 mm (1.6 inches)83%moderate
